Radio boys was the title of three series of juvenile fiction books published by rival companies in the united states in the 1920s. It is set in the 1910 era when radio was just coming on the scene.

Keeline allen chapman was a pseudonym of the stratemeyer syndicate, a book packager, to use a modern phrase, which was responsible for many popular juvenile series books published between 1905 and 1986, including the bobbsey twins, tom swift, hardy boys, and nancy drew books, among thers. By his own account, morgan first became interested in the new technology of radio in 1903 and garnered sufficient details from articles in scientific american to build a simple spark set that could communicate several hundred feet. Journalist gerald breckenridge wrote a 10 volume radio boys series that ran from 1922 to 1931. There were at least three different radio boys series running from 1922 to 1931 as well as a four volume radio girls series by margaret penrose from 1922 to 1924. The early 1920s were said to be the boom years in broadcasting, a time when everyone was suddenly interested in having a radio set in their homes. A number of competing publishers came out, more or less simultaneously, with series called the radio boys.
